Aren't they based off the same architecture and chip pretty much??

And isn't it the same as the whole war between the Xbox 360 vs. PS3

DROID + iPhone 3GS have a dedicated GPU which is better than the Snapdragons integrated. But Snapdragon just has a better CPU? In reality, if developers utilize the GPU in the DROID like they do in the iPhone 3GS, it will get better framerates and do better in gaming. That's why the iPhone 3GS still gets better framerates than the Nexus One.

Feel free to correct me if im wrong, but the DROID still does have potential over snapdragon.
They are both ARM architecture chips, yes.

Both the Cortex A8 and Snapdragon are System on a Chip (SoC) design, so they both have integrated GPUs. Apparently Motorola decided they wanted an external as well. Maybe HTC will do the same with the Incredible?
